HI 00620.200 Exclusion of Refractive Services
   
   
   
   Expenses for  all eye refraction procedures, whether performed by an opthalmologist (or any other physician)
      or by an optometrist and without regard to the reason for the performance of the refraction,
      are excluded from coverage under the program. Although payment can be made for the
      prosthetic lenses (e.g., following cataract surgery) and any incidental charges that
      may be assessed for the fitting thereof, no payment can be made in such cases for
      the procedures performed to determine the refractive state of the eye.
   
   
   All of the services and procedures are excluded where an eye examination is performed
      for the purpose of prescribing, fitting, or changing eyeglasses without regard to
      whether these services are furnished by a physician or by another practitioner. (see
      HI 00620.110.).
